Transaction fbeddb3538f324ae63ebbef6233811e0131b21cb38aa0335d4a9a9499b3563af

1 Input
2 Outputs
  • fbeddb3538f324ae63ebbef6233811e0131b21cb38aa0335d4a9a9499b3563af:0
  • value  3300000
    address  395H9rbTZKLuGCeHe23Mayxe1J7D8KLWzW
  • fbeddb3538f324ae63ebbef6233811e0131b21cb38aa0335d4a9a9499b3563af:1
  • value  192943530
    address  34mL6iGbzKsfd9sE1CSQ6XjU4rQnyiYx8i